ESC % n
Select/cancel user-defined character set.
Selects or cancels the user-defined character set.

When the LSB of n is 0, the user-defined character set is canceled.

When the LSB of n is 1, the user-defined character set is selected.

When the user-defined character set is canceled, the built-in character set is
automatically selected.

n is available only for the least significant bit.
ESC ? n

Cancels user-defined characters.
This command cancels the patterns defined for the character codes specified by
n. After the user-defined characters are canceled, the corresponding patterns
for the internal characters are printed.
If a user-defined characters have not been defined, the printer ignores this
command.
